As the name suggests, the ball valve is a large sphere housed within the part of the valve itself.  A hole is drilled into the ball, and this is then placed within the pipe. The brilliance of the ball valve is that the ball can rotate. This then exposes the hole that has been drilled through. It can then be turned again to close the valve. This action will allow, limit or completely close off flow for whatever substance is in the pipe.

The ball valve is an excellent substitution over a gate valve as it provides significantly reduced resistance to the flowing subject than a gate valve will. The ball valve is simpler to position on a fully open option. The spherical valve will last longer as well.

The significant advantage that the ball valve has over the many other options is that it can be quickly adjusted to the needs of what is going through the pipe. When there might be a need for an emergency  shut off the ball valve is a good option as it can be manipulated quickly.
